Summary
Calculate linear momentum (p = mv) or impulse (J = F×Δt). Solve for any unknown given two known values, with full metric and imperial unit support.

Use cases
- Solve physics homework problems on linear momentum and conservation laws.
- Calculate the impulse delivered by a force over a time interval.
- Convert momentum between SI units (kg·m/s) and imperial units (lb·ft/s).
- Verify collision or explosion calculations in mechanics coursework.
- Determine the mass or velocity of an object from its known momentum.
